FAQ

What is Ashland's cash & equivalents?
Ashland (ASH) reported cash & equivalents of $440M in Q2 2026.
How has Ashland's cash & equivalents changed year-over-year?
Ashland's cash & equivalents increased by 112.6% year-over-year, from $207M to $440M.
What is the long-term trend for Ashland's cash & equivalents?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Ashland's cash & equivalents has grown at a 0.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$210M to $215M.
What does cash & equivalents mean?
Cash on hand plus highly liquid investments with maturities of three months or less at purchase — treasury bills, money market funds, and commercial paper.
